Located in Shelton Washington, a Title 1 school district, many of my students receive food from our food bag program because they don't have food to eat at home. In addition, our school is lacking parent support and extra funds to purchase items needed for enriching lessons. Teachers are spending their own money to buy math games, art supplies, flash cards, math manipulatives, and other things needs to enhance our classroom curriculum and make learning fun and contextual for our students. My students love to have art time and create special pieces. It is hard for me to find the time in my busy schedule to do so, but when I do, we are lacking supplies.
